Production Associate | 3rd Shift | $24.75/hr
Build Your Career in Food & Beverage Production
Join a growing, stable manufacturing team where quality, safety, and consistency matter. This entry-level Production Associate role focuses on safely receiving, handling, and processing milk while supporting overnight operations in a fast-paced, regulated environment.
What You’ll Do
- Receive, handle, and process milk in compliance with state regulations and company standards
- Follow established procedures to ensure safe, efficient product flow
- Support production and warehouse tasks, including loading, unloading, and staging materials
- Maintain clean, organized work areas to keep operations running smoothly
- Complete required documentation accurately with strong attention to detail
- Use basic computer and Microsoft Office skills for data entry and recordkeeping
- Work with team members to meet production goals and maintain product quality
- Follow all food safety, quality, and workplace safety standards
- Report any issues related to quality, equipment, or safety
- Manage tasks independently when needed and stay productive throughout the shift
- Learn and follow evolving processes and procedures
What You Bring
- Ability to lift and move up to 50 pounds regularly
- Strong attention to detail and accuracy in documentation
- Ability to work both independently and on a team in a fast-paced setting
- Willingness to learn and adapt
- Experience in warehouse, production, or general labor environments
- Basic Microsoft Office skills
Preferred Experience
- Background in production, manufacturing, or warehouse operations
- Experience in food and beverage or other regulated industries
- Comfort working in structured environments with established processes
